Shares Outstanding
The total number of shares of a corporation that have been issued and are currently held by investors, including the public and the company's officers and insiders.
After-Tax Cash Flow
The amount of net cash flow from operations after adjusting for taxes, providing insight into a company's financial viability after tax obligations.
Perpetual
Perpetual pertains to something that never ends or changes, often used in finance to describe a type of bond with no maturity date.
Discount Rate
The interest rate that an investment's cash flows are discounted at to calculate its present value, often reflecting the risk and opportunity cost associated with the investment.
